Is Harker Heights or Los Angeles Safer?
According to crimebycity.com's analysis of 2024 FBI data, Harker Heights is safer than Los Angeles (Safety Score 69/100 vs 35/100), with a total crime rate of 1,125 per 100,000 versus 2,212 for Los Angeles — 49% lower. Harker Heights has lower rates in 7 of 7 crime categories.
The biggest difference is in murder, where Harker Heights has a 100% lower rate.
Note: Los Angeles is 108.9x larger by coverage, which can affect crime rate comparisons. Larger cities tend to report higher rates due to density and more comprehensive reporting.

Detailed Crime Rate Comparison
| Crime Type | Harker Heights | Los Angeles |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Crime Rate | 1,124.6 | 2,212.5 | -1,087.9 |
| Violent Crime Rate | 134.8 | 728.5 | -593.7 |
| Murder Rate | 0.0 | 7.0 | -7.0 |
| Rape Rate | 43.0 | 40.3 | +2.7 |
| Robbery Rate | 14.3 | 209.9 | -195.5 |
| Aggravated Assault Rate | 77.5 | 471.4 | -393.9 |
| Property Crime Rate | 989.7 | 1,483.9 | -494.2 |
| Burglary Rate | 180.7 | 372.8 | -192.1 |
| Larceny-Theft Rate | 722.9 | 851.5 | -128.6 |
| Motor Vehicle Theft Rate | 86.1 | 259.6 | -173.6 |
All rates per 100,000 residents. Source: FBI UCR 2024.

About Harker Heights, TX
Harker Heights, a central Texas city, grew around Fort Hood (now Fort Cavazos), influencing its diverse, military-affiliated population. Situated in Bell County, it offers a mix of residential areas and commercial development. With a safety score of 69/100 and a population coverage of 34,858, Harker Heights has a total crime rate of 1,124.6 per 100,000 residents.
About Los Angeles, CA
Los Angeles, a sprawling Southern California metropolis, is a major Pacific Rim gateway, home to Hollywood's film industry. Its diverse population of nearly 4 million people resides across a vast urban landscape bordered by mountains and the Pacific Ocean. With a safety score of 35/100 and a population coverage of 3,796,352, Los Angeles has a total crime rate of 2,212.5 per 100,000 residents.
